Transparent conductive glass (TCG) substances possess the intriguing characteristic to transmit light while simultaneously conducting electricity. This unique attribute has fueled a surge in research and applications across various sectors. From adaptable displays and touchscreens to solar cells and clear electronics, TCG is revolutionizing the way we utilize technology.

Influencers Determining the Price of Conductive Glass

The expense of conductive glass can be determined by a number of factors. Substrate costs, which include the kind of glass and the conducting substance used, are a significant {consideration|. A costlier material will inherently result in a higher final expense. Production processes can also influence the price, with complex techniques requiring higher labor and tools. The quantity of conductive glass being acquired can also have an impact a role, with wholesale acquisitions often receiving reductions.

Additionally, the demand for conductive glass can change over time, causing to price adjustments. Factors such as government standards, innovation in the field, and economic conditions can all contribute to these fluctuations.
